hen <02004>

Nh hen

Pronunciation:hane
Origin:from 01931
Reference:TWOT - 504
PrtSpch:pers pron 3f pl (personal pronoun third person feminime plural)
In Hebrew:Nhb 9, Nhm 2, Nhk 1
In NET:them 3, in them 1, example 1, in it 1, they 1, uninhabited 1, those 1, with 1
In AV:therein 4, withal 3, which 2, they 2, for 1, like 1, them 1, thereby 1, wherein 1
Count:16
Definition : 1) they, these, the same, who
feminine plural from 1931; they (only used when emphatic): KJV -- X in, such like, (with) them, thereby, therein, (more than) they, wherein, in which, whom, withal.
